我从db中得到了x行数量,这些行与“汇总rows”相加。在这些行中,我还想把结果列等于'win‘的那些行相加。我也看不出有“全胜”的回音。
知道我做错什么了吗?
提前谢谢。
public static function getList( $numRows=10000, $order="id DESC" ) {
$conn = new PDO( DB_DSN, DB_USERNAME, DB_PASSWORD );
$sql = "SELECT SQL_CALC_FOUND_ROWS * FROM table
ORDER BY " . my
我正在执行以下查询:
select count(*),ACTION_DATE from SUMMARY group by ACTION_DATE where NUM_ACTIONS=500;
这给了我ORA-00933 SQL命令没有正确的结束,我不知道为什么。
汇总是表,ACTION_DATE和NUM_ACTIONS是列。所以我期待的是每次和num_actions=500约会。
如果有人能看出这个命令出了什么问题,我们会很感激的,谢谢
我想将下面的sql查询转换为symfony中的原则查询。
select p.name,p.id,sum(t.amount) as bal from transactions t right join processors p on t.processor_id=p.id where user_id=18 or user_id is null group by p.id
上述代码通过为每个处理器的用户汇总每个事务的数量,从事务表中获取平衡。
结果:
Processor1 ? 43。
Processor2 ? 12
Processor3
Processor4
Processor5
我用dql尝试的
我有两个存储过程,其中一个返回支付列表,另一个返回按货币分组的支付摘要。现在,我有一个重复的查询:返回支付列表的存储过程的主查询是按货币返回支付摘要的存储过程的子查询。我想通过使返回支付列表的存储过程成为按货币返回支付汇总的存储过程的子查询来消除这种重复。这在SQL Server 2008中是可能的吗?
我想知道在sql查询中,excel的加法是否有等价的功能?
特别是对于roundup(value,2)
在使用圆形的SQL中:
select cast(ROUND(350.00/24,2) as decimal(18,2))
result = 14.58
在Excel中使用汇总
result = 14.59
如何在sql中实现excel的汇总结果?
我想做一些如下的事情:
DELETE UserPredictions
GROUP BY UserId
HAVING COUNT(*) < 500
但是我得到了一个语法错误。是否可以在SQL Server中使用HAVING子句执行delete操作,或者我是否必须将计数汇总到CTE中并使用join执行delete操作?
proc sql;
update summary tmp1
set E_1ST_CLICK_DT = min (tmp1.E_1ST_CLICK_DT, (select E_1ST_CLICK_DT from CLICK_SUMM tmp2
where tmp1.card_number = tmp2.card_number
and tmp1.package_sk = tmp2.package_sk))
where exists (select 1 from CLICK_SUMM tmp2
我们刚刚建立了一个在午夜收集数据的系统。它必须遍历几个表的组合,以便汇总所需的数据。不幸的是,UPDATE查询耗时很长。我们有1/1000的预测用户数,每天仅用我们的测试版用户就需要28分钟来汇总我们的数据。
由于主要的滞后是UPDATE查询,可能很难委托服务器来处理数据处理。优化数百万个UPDATE查询的其他选择是什么?我的伸缩问题是在下面的代码中吗?
$sql = "SELECT ab_id, persistence, count(*) as no_x FROM $query_table ftbl
WHERE ftbl.$query_
我的应用程序中有平面数据,我需要像通常使用sql查询一样对这些数据进行分组、汇总和计数。但是,对于这个项目,它必须在flex应用程序中完成。我需要弄清楚如何使用Arraycollection中的datatime字段按天或月对数据进行分组,然后对其他字段中的数据进行适当的计数或汇总。我以前使用过Groupingcollections,但仅在绑定到分层控件(如AdvancedDataGrid和树)时使用,但我需要一个包含分组和汇总数据的结果ArrayCollection。
基本上,我试图像sql表一样访问我的AC (GROUP BY MONTH(datetime),COUNT,COUNT(DIST
使用rollup.config.js文件获取下面的错误消息
warning.indexOf不是�函数
rollup.config.js
import nodeResolve from 'rollup-plugin-node-resolve'
import commonjs from 'rollup-plugin-commonjs';
import uglify from 'rollup-plugin-uglify'
//paths are relative to the execution path
export default
我有一个sql表中的数据,如下所示:
Name colno remark
---- ----- ------
bill col 1 good
bill col 2 ok
bill col 3 triff
bill col 4 A1
bob col 1 poor
bob col 2 excellent
bob col 3 ok
bob col 4 B+
bert col 1
bert col 2 no info
bert col 3
我使用rollup对包含字段company、sales、cost和margin的表进行求和。这为我提供了汇总的列,但我需要显示每个公司摘要的毛利的汇总百分比作为销售额的百分比。
这是我目前的声明:
SELECT coalesce(CAST(Company AS VARCHAR(30)), 'Grand Total:') AS Company,
SUM(Sales) AS 'TOTSALES',
SUM(CostVal)
这是我在使用mysql_num_rows()函数时遇到的错误
Error: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ource
以下是我的源代码:
$title = "SELECT * FROM item WHERE item.title LIKE % " .implode("% OR item.title LIKE % ", $data);
$title_result = mysql_query($title, $this->dbh);
e
我正在MS SQL Server中使用T-SQL。
我有一张这样的桌子:
Category Value
A 150
B 200
C 300
A 120
A 300
C 500
D 200
...
我想得到一个像这样的汇总表:
DistinctCategory Value>100 Value>200 Value>300 .
如何跨多个表重用单个复杂数据集?
数据集具有许多需要详细和摘要报告的计算列。下面是一个非常简单的示例数据集:
is_food sale_association food_type total_sold total_associations percent_total
1 Before Movie Popcorn 50 3 x BirtMath.safeDivide(...)
0 Before Movie Soda 10 2